Is it possible to test whether a jQuery object has a particular method? I've been looking, but so far without success. Thanks!
This should work:
if (!!$.prototype.functionName)
Because jQuery methods are prototype into a jQuery object, you can test it from the prototype object.
if( $.isFunction( $.fn.someMethod ) ) {
// it exists
}
This uses the jQuery.isFunction()[docs] method to see if $.fn.someMethod is indeed a function. (In jQuery jQuery.fn is a reference to the prototype object.)
try
if ($.fn.method) {
$('a').method(...);
}
or
if ($.method) {
$.method(...);
}
